Course Overview

The Materials Science and Engineering program at Michigan State University focuses on the study, design, and development of materials that shape modern technology. The curriculum emphasizes the relationship between the structure, properties, and performance of materials, preparing students to solve real-world challenges in industries such as aerospace, automotive, and biomedical engineering. Unique features include hands-on laboratory experiences and opportunities for undergraduate research.

Career Prospects

Graduates are equipped for diverse roles in industries that rely on advanced materials, with strong demand in sectors like manufacturing, energy, and healthcare. The program fosters skills in innovation and problem-solving, leading to high employability.

Key Faculty and Staff

While specific faculty names are subject to change, the department is staffed by experts in areas such as nanomaterials, biomaterials, and computational materials science, many of whom are recognized leaders in their fields.

Unique Facilities and Partnerships

The program offers access to state-of-the-art facilities, including advanced microscopy and materials testing labs. Students benefit from partnerships with industry leaders and research centers, providing opportunities for internships and collaborative projects.
